Two alleged members of the Dawlah Islamiyah-Hassan Group were killed while two others were injured and arrested in an armed encounter in Barangay Libutan, Mamasapano, Maguindanao del Sur on Sunday, June 22, 2025.

According to the 6th Infantry Division (6ID), the troops of the 6th Infantry Battalion, 33rd Infantry Battalion, and other operating units launched a military operation after receiving information that the members of the terrorist group were gathering and planning to plant improvised explosive devices (IEDs) in crowded places in the area.

During the operation, two members of the group were killed. They were residents of Datu Odin Sinsuat, Maguindanao del Norte and Guindulungan, Maguindanao del Sur.

Two others were also injured and arrested. They were brought to the hospital for treatment.

The military seized from the clash site two M16A1 rifles, a caliber .45 pistol, components of IED, an unexploded ordnance, cellphones, a monocular scope, fake IDs, and communication devices, among others.

601st Infantry Brigade Commander, Brigadier General Edgar Catu, ordered the troops to pursue other members of the group who escaped.

Catu said the group has alleged links to the killing of three businessmen from Batangas on May 30, 2025.

The victims who had traveled to Maguindanao del Sur reportedly to deliver goats were found dead and buried at a rubber plantation in Barangay Nabundas, Shariff Saydona Mustapha.

The group was also allegedly involved in the ambush of military troops in Datu Hoffer in March 2024 that killed four soldiers.
